Africa approves new AI strategy

It was adopted during the AU Executive Council’s 45th Ordinary Session in Accra, Ghana, on July 18–19, 2024, and endorsed by African ICT and Communications Ministers in June 2024.

The AU emphasised AI as a strategic asset for achieving Agenda 2063 and Sustainable Development Goals, promising to ignite new industries, fuel innovation, and create high-value jobs while preserving African culture and integration.

“AI is more than a technological leap; it is a transformative force reshaping our world. With far-reaching impacts across economics, society, and geopolitics, AI is driving revolutionary changes in healthcare, agriculture, finance, and education.

“For Africa, AI is a strategic asset pivotal to achieving the aspirations of Agenda 2063 and Sustainable Development Goals. It promises to ignite new industries, fuel innovation, and create high-value jobs while preserving and advancing African culture and integration,” the union stated.

Earlier in June, over 130 African ministers and experts virtually converged for the AU’s 2nd Extraordinary Session of the Specialised Technical Committee on Communication and ICT.
